The CanRail pass is our most comprehensive and most popular pass. It covers the whole country from Nova Scotia on the east coast to Vancouver Island in the west, and as far north as the shores of Hudson Bay. So you could take in Halifax, Quebec City, Montreal, Toronto, the Rockies and Vancouver.
Valid for travel across the whole VIA Rail network this is the best pass for travel across the whole of Canada.
It allows 12 days comfort class travel (doesn't have to be consecutive days) in a 30-day period and is ideal for seeing as much as possible in this huge country. And it'll save you money on accommodation, as many of our long distance trains are overnight, so no need for a room for the night.

With a CanRail pass you are entitled to:
- Coach class travel
- Unlimited stopovers
- 12, 13, 14 or 15 days of unlimited travel within a 30 day period
- Travel days do not need to be consecutive
- Cheaper passes if you are travelling in off peak periods
- Children aged 2-11 years inclusive are entitled to discounted pass prices
- Students aged 12-17 years inclusive and those aged 18 years and over with a valid ISIC card are entitled to discounted pass prices
- Seniors aged 60 years and over are entitled to discounted pass prices
